The Crazy Bubbles format in Prague: two hours, up to 10 games

This is a short, high-energy group activity built around one simple idea: you bounce into inflatable bubbles and play games inside them. Your session runs about 2 hours, and the package is designed so you can rotate through as many as 10 different game types during that time.
Instead of doing one big game and calling it done, you’ll likely get a rhythm: quick games, brief resets, and enough variety to keep energy up for the whole group. If you’re planning a bachelor party, birthday, or team fun day, this format is practical because nobody has to wait around too long.
The star activity is bubble football, sometimes called Crayz Bubbles in the program. Still, the key value is that bubble football is only one part of the menu, with more than a dozen possible bubble games on the list.

Where you play: four indoor/outdoor options and a sports-ground fee

Your event is run at one of four sites, and the program works year-round with both indoor and outdoor options. The location you end up at can affect what you wear, how the ground feels, and how you think about weather.
One item you must plan for: the sports area price is not included. The provider says you pay the sports ground fee in cash on the day of your event. They also note there are multiple places to play, so it’s not a fixed location issue—but the cash fee is real, so don’t show up assuming the entire cost is settled.
If you’re organizing for a larger company group, I’d treat this as part of your budget planning. Bring enough cash for the venue fee day-of so the group doesn’t lose time later.
Meeting point in Prague: easy start near public transport

You start at Polská 2400/1A, Vinohrady, 120 00 Prague (Prague 2). The session ends back at the meeting point, which keeps the logistics simple. There’s no long travel plan, no multi-stop route, and no complicated ending.
The provider notes it’s near public transportation, so you have options if you’re not using a taxi. That matters in Prague, where planning for transport can be half the battle.
The activity is private, meaning it’s only your group. If you’re the type of organizer who wants control—no mixed crowds, no waiting for strangers—this is a big plus.
Group size, bubbles, and how many people you can actually fit

The price is listed as $533.74 per group (up to 15). At the same time, the details mention the stated price is an average for renting 8 bubbles for a 2-hour program and maximum of 20 pax.
So here’s the practical way to interpret it: the package is clearly built around using bubble balls efficiently, but exact participation capacity can vary based on how many people you bring and how the instructor team schedules rotation. If you’re near that upper end, it’s smart to confirm how the group will be distributed across bubbles during the 2 hours.
They also mention larger packages are available with discounts for larger groups. They can arrange Crazy Bubbles events with more bubbles and/or longer duration. You’ll often get the best value when you scale the event to your group size instead of forcing everyone into the minimum setup.

FAQ
How long is Crazy Bubbles in Prague?
The activity runs for about 2 hours.
How many people is this for?
It’s priced per group up to 15, and the stated setup is for up to 20 participants for the 2-hour rental of 8 bubbles.
What games are included?
You can play up to 10 types of games during the session, chosen from a list of more than a dozen bubble activity types, including bubble football (Crayz Bubbles).
What’s included in the price?
Included are 8 bumper balls, up to 10 types of games, organization by instructors, all equipment for the games, snacks for everyone, and optional alcoholic or non-alcoholic drinks plus an optional photo report.
Where do we meet?
Meet at Polská 2400/1A, Vinohrady, 120 00 Prague 2.
Are the sports grounds included?
No. The sports ground fee is not included, and you pay it in cash on the day of the event.
Is this a private activity?
Yes. It’s a private tour/activity, so only your group participates.
Is the activity indoors or outdoors?
Both are available. The programs run year-round with indoor and outdoor options.
What if I need to cancel?
This experience is non-refundable and cannot be changed for any reason. If you cancel or request an amendment, the amount paid will not be refunded.
